Vodafone is one of the UK’s premier mobile broadband providers as they brought the mobile phone service to the UK alongside Orange in 1995.  As such, they are able to offer security to their customers and the knowledge that their offers will stand true unlike smaller competitors who often provide little more than their terms and conditions imply if not less.

Vodafone is able to offer almost the entire UK 2G coverage and at 70% coverage for its 3G coverage is a major force to be reckoned with.  One advantage with working with Vodafone is that there are also shops around the UK for consumers to walk in and visit so those who enjoy doing their business on a personal basis like the fact they have an option of a salesclerk and the freedom of internet browsing when it comes to contracts and mobile offers.

While Vodafone is able to offer the widest coverage area for 3G, it comes at a price as their broadband contracts start at the high end of £15 per month for their lowest rate.  However, in exchange, you do get access to the fastest broadband provider across the UK at a stunning 7.2Mb top speed.

The company has however recently offered a few new contracts to help entice customers to its network with a mobile broadband portfolio and a one month contract for those who are contact shy.

The 3GB package charges £15 for each additional GB and the 5GB charges the same, so it is wise to monitor your GB use before choosing which will best fit your needs.

Vodafone’s standard packages are 12, 18, and 24 months and users who do not purchase 5GB contracts on the latter two extended plans do have to pay something for their modem which is rated according to the expense of the plan.
